The 2024 refresh (adopted in 2025 model) incorporated exterior styling inspired by the FR performance variant and major upgrades to the cockpit / software / charging architecture. The 2025 update introduces the Haohan Smart Driving 2.0 system with significantly improved autonomy hardware compared to previous Mobileye-based systems. The charging architecture upgrade to 800 V is a major shift enabling very high power charging (peak ~ 546 kW claimed) in refreshed model marketing. Some controversy among early buyers over frequent model updates (i.e. product cycles) has been publicly reported in China. The 2025 variant is positioned to compete more strongly in performance / technology with other premium EVs, leveraging its shooting-brake styling plus high-end tech features |
